The Cystic Fibrosis (CF) test is a comprehensive genetic analysis used to diagnose cystic fibrosis, a hereditary disorder affecting the lungs and digestive system. This test examines DNA for mutations in the Cystic Fibrosis Transmembrane Conductance Regulator (CFTR) gene. It can be used for diagnostic purposes in individuals showing symptoms of CF, for carrier screening in adults planning to have children, and for newborn screening. The test results provide valuable information for genetic counseling and help guide treatment strategies for affected individuals.
